An optical fiber has index of refraction `n=1.40` and diameter `d=100 mu m`. It is surrounded by air. Light is sent into the fiber along the axis as shown in figure. If smallest outside radius R permitted for a bend in the fiber for no light to escape is given by `50 x ("in" mu m)` fill value of x.

The correct Answer is:
7


A ray along the inner edge will escape. Its angle of incidence is described by `sin theta = (R-d)/(R )` and by n `sin theta gt sin `90^(@)`
Then `(n(R-d))/(R ) gt 1 nR - nd gt R nR -R gt nd R gt (nd)/(n-1)`
`R_(min) =(1.40(100xx10^(-6)m))/(0.40) =350xx 10^(-6)m`
